What Is a Palm Fruit Digester Machine?
The palm fruit digester machine is a core piece of equipment used to process palm fruitlets after they have been detached from the bunch during palm oil processing. In the palm oil pressing process, following sterilization and fruit threshing, the fruitlets enter the digester machine for mashing and cooking; this breaks down the pulp cell structure, making it easier to extract the oil.
Simply put, the function of the palm fruit digester can be summarized by three keywords: heating, mashing, and cell-wall disruption. Through the combined action of high temperature and mechanical force, it transforms the palm fruit into a pulp suitable for pressing.
Working Principles of the Palm Fruit Digester Machine
1) Basic Equipment Structure
The palm fruit digester is typically a steam-heated cylindrical vessel featuring a central rotating shaft equipped with multiple stirring paddles (beater arms). This structural design enables the equipment to simultaneously perform heating and stirring/mashing operations.
Depending on specific production process requirements, digesters can be categorized into types such as spherical digesters and horizontal or vertical cylindrical digesters.
2) Core Operational Process
The operation of the palm fruit digester machine involves the following main steps:
Step 1: Feeding. Palm fruitlets that have undergone sterilization and threshing are conveyed into the digester.
Step 2: Steam Heating. Low-pressure steam is introduced into the digester machine to heat the palm fruit. The digestion temperature is typically maintained between 90°C and 100°C. Heating at high temperatures softens the fruit pulp and reduces oil viscosity, facilitating subsequent pressing and extraction.
Step 3: Stirring and Mashing. While heating takes place, a central rotating shaft drives stirring paddles at high speed to mash the palm fruit. Through the mechanical action of the paddles, the fruit skin is torn, the pulp tissue is mashed, and the oil-bearing cells are thoroughly ruptured.
Step 4: Discharge. After thorough cooking and mashing, the palm fruit is transformed into a uniform pulp; it is then discharged through the outlet and conveyed to the next stage: palm oil pressing.
3) Key Principles of Operation
In summary, the operating principle of the palm fruit digester can be categorized into three core mechanisms:
Thermal Softening: High-temperature steam softens the pulp tissue and reduces oil viscosity.
Mechanical Cell Disruption: The impact and shearing action of the rotating stirring paddles break down the fruit skin and oil cell walls.
Homogenization: The stirring action ensures uniform heating and consistent pulp quality, creating optimal conditions for pressing.
As noted in relevant research, the role of the digester machine in a palm oil mill is to “mash the mesocarp away from the nut while rupturing oil-bearing cells, thereby preparing the material for oil extraction.”

3) The Role of the Digester in the Palm Oil Production Line
In the complete palm oil production line provided by Huatai Oil Machinery, digestion is the core stage of the pressing section, situated after sterilization and threshing but before pressing. The complete process flow is as follows:
Raw Material Reception → Sterilization → Threshing → Digestion (Cooking & Mashing) → Pressing → Crude Palm Oil Clarification
The quality of the digestion process directly determines the oil yield and crude oil quality during the palm oil pressing stage, making it an indispensable, critical step in the entire palm oil processing operation.
